MEDIUM: counters: factor out smp_fetch_sc*_http_req_rate

smp_fetch_sc0_http_req_rate, smp_fetch_sc1_http_req_rate, smp_fetch_sc2_http_req_rate,
smp_fetch_src_http_req_rate and smp_fetch_http_req_rate were merged into a single
function which relies on the fetch name to decide what to return.
diff --git a/src/session.c b/src/session.c
index 9e3e8b2..a0e1c96 100644
--- a/src/session.c
+++ b/src/session.c
@@ -2919,80 +2919,32 @@
 	return 1;
 }
 
-/* set temp integer to the session rate in the stksess entry <ts> over the configured period */
+/* set <smp> to the HTTP request rate from the session's tracked frontend
+ * counters. Supports being called as "sc[0-9]_http_req_rate" or
+ * "src_http_req_rate" only.
+ */
 static int
-smp_fetch_http_req_rate(struct stktable *table, struct sample *smp, struct stksess *ts)
+smp_fetch_sc_http_req_rate(struct proxy *px, struct session *l4, void *l7, unsigned int opt,
+                           const struct arg *args, struct sample *smp, const char *kw)
 {
+	struct stkctr *stkctr = smp_fetch_sc_stkctr(l4, args, kw);
+
+	if (!stkctr)
+		return 0;
+
 	smp->flags = SMP_F_VOL_TEST;
 	smp->type = SMP_T_UINT;
 	smp->data.uint = 0;
-	if (ts != NULL) {
-		void *ptr = stktable_data_ptr(table, ts, STKTABLE_DT_HTTP_REQ_RATE);
+	if (stkctr->entry != NULL) {
+		void *ptr = stktable_data_ptr(stkctr->table, stkctr->entry, STKTABLE_DT_HTTP_REQ_RATE);
 		if (!ptr)
 			return 0; /* parameter not stored */
 		smp->data.uint = read_freq_ctr_period(&stktable_data_cast(ptr, http_req_rate),
-					       table->data_arg[STKTABLE_DT_HTTP_REQ_RATE].u);
+					       stkctr->table->data_arg[STKTABLE_DT_HTTP_REQ_RATE].u);
 	}
 	return 1;
 }
